Turkey Cupcakes
- No symbol is more synonymous with Thanksgiving then the turkey (although they would be more than happy to give the honor to the chicken). To start, you will need several cupcakes. Most designs use chocolate frosted cupcakes. However, you could also cover any cupcake with chocolate candy sprinkles to look like feathers.Gather: Turkey Cupcakes by Leanarda S. Then, you can use some of the following ideas to create different features on your cupcakes:
- Head
- You have many options to choose from when making your turkey's head:
- Try placing oval shortbread cookies on the cupcake.FamilyFun.com: Thanksgiving Recipes: Sweet T.O.M. Turkey Cupcakes Recipe
- Use Nutter Butter cookies by pushing the cookie upright into the cupcake.FamilyFun.com: Thanksgiving Recipes: Gobbling-Good Cupcakes Recipe
- Cover miniature peanut butter cups in frosting for a tasty treat.About.com: Thanksgiving Cupcakes - Turkey Cupcakes
- Pipe a large mound of chocolate frosting on one side of the cupcake.Gather: Turkey Cupcakes by Leanarda S.
- Take a large gumdrop and press a candy corn into the center at an angle for the beak.Bigoven: Turkey Cupcakes Recipe
- Eyes
- Use dabs of frosting to stick mini chocolate chips for the eyes.FamilyFun.com: Thanksgiving Recipes: Gobbling-Good Cupcakes Recipe
- Try using white decorating icing or white chocolate chips and add brown or black decorating gel to create pupils.Gather: Turkey Cupcakes by Leanarda S. About.com: Thanksgiving Cupcakes - Turkey Cupcakes
- Beak
- The most common way to create a beak is by using candy corn.About.com: Thanksgiving Cupcakes - Turkey Cupcakes
- For a smaller beak, cut the tip off a piece of candy corn.FamilyFun.com: Thanksgiving Recipes: Sweet T.O.M. Turkey Cupcakes Recipe
- Wattle
- The wattle can be made out of red fruit leather.FamilyFun.com: Thanksgiving Recipes: Sweet T.O.M. Turkey Cupcakes Recipe
- You can also cut a red gumdrop into thin strips and press one below the beak.Bigoven: Turkey Cupcakes Recipe
- Feathers / Tail
- Select one of these options when making a tail:
- Use candy corn to create feathers by inserting them tip down around one side of the cupcake.FamilyFun.com: Thanksgiving Recipes: Sweet T.O.M. Turkey Cupcakes Recipe
- You can also cut fruit leather into feather shapes and stick it into the cupcakes with the aid of toothpicks.FamilyFun.com: Thanksgiving Recipes: Gobbling-Good Cupcakes Recipe
- For an inedible tail, use construction paper by cutting out feather shapes.Spatulatta: Thanksgiving Sides

Pilgrim Hat Cupcakes
- Pilgrim hats are another festive Thanksgiving option. Here are a couple ways to turn your ordinary cupcake into a snazzy pilgrim hat.
- You can turn a chocolate frosted cupcake into a pilgrim hat fairly simply by using a chocolate covered marshmallow.FamilyFun.com: Marshmallow Pilgrim Hats Recipe
- Get creative by using an ice cream cone as your cupcake batter mold. When the cupcake is baked, simply cover with frosting and decorate.FamilyFun.com: Hats Off to Thanksgiving

Stenciling Cupcakes
- A quick and easy way to decorate cupcakes is to stencil a design over the top of them. To do this, all you need is frosted cupcakes, a topping and a stencil. You can also use this technique to decorate cakes, cookies and brownies. Images that are associated with thanksgiving include turkeys, pilgrim hats, cornucopias (the horn shaped object filled with vegetables), pumpkins, maple leaves and Native Americans.
- There are a variety of toppings you can use to make your design including:
- Colored sugar.About.com: How to Make Colored Sugar
- Colored powdered sugar.FabulousFoods.com: How to Make Tinted Sugars and Coconut (July 29, 2007)
- Colored coconut.FabulousFoods.com: How to Make Tinted Sugars and Coconut (July 29, 2007)
- Sanding sugar.MarthaStewart.com: Stenciled Halloween Cakes
- Ground ginger and confectioners' sugar.MarthaStewart.com: Stenciled Halloween Cakes
- Cocoa powder and cinnamon.Slashfood: How to Make Cupcake Stencils
- Cupcake and cookie stencils are fairly inexpensive and are sold by Wilton online.Wilton: Autumn Cupcake and Cookie Stencils However, you can make your own stencils very easily. Mini Thanksgiving Dinner Cupcakes
- You can create a miniature edible Thanksgiving dinner on your cupcakes with a little bit of work. You will need: round shaped cookies, yellow frosting, maple nut candies, white frosting, yellow gel food coloring, butterscotch or chocolate chips, vegetable oil, green sprinkles or nonpareil, red nonpareils or sugar. Then, you can create the various dishes by doing the following:
- Plate: Set a round cookie on top of a cupcake and cover it with yellow frosting.Recipezaar: Mini Thanksgiving Dinner Cupcakes Recipe
- Turkey slices: Thinly slice maple nut candies, and place them in layers on the plate.Recipezaar: Mini Thanksgiving Dinner Cupcakes Recipe
- Mashed potatoes: Place a dab of white frosting next to the turkey. Add a little bit of yellow gel food coloring on top for the butter.Recipezaar: Mini Thanksgiving Dinner Cupcakes Recipe
- Gravy: Melt butterscotch or chocolate chips with a little bit of vegetable oil. Drizzle over the turkey.Recipezaar: Mini Thanksgiving Dinner Cupcakes Recipe FamilyFun.com: Tiny Turkey Dinner
- Cranberries: Place a small amount of red nonpareils or sugar.An American Housewife: Mini Thanksgiving Dinner Cupcakes
- Green Beans: Place a small amount of long green sprinkles.An American Housewife: Mini Thanksgiving Dinner Cupcakes
- Peas: Place a small amount of green nonpareils to create peas instead of beans.FamilyFun.com: Tiny Turkey Dinner

Other Ideas
- Here are a few other ideas that you can use to create Thanksgiving themed cupcakes:
- Use candy leaves and pumpkins to decorate the top of your cupcakes.Mrs. Beasley's: Thanksgiving Cupcakes
- Orange, yellow and brown sprinkles make a colorful trim.Mrs. Beasley's: Thanksgiving Cupcakes
- If you use icing to write guests' names on the cupcakes, they can be used for placecards.Pink Cake Box Wedding Cakes: Thanksgiving Placecard Cupcakes
- Top your cupcake with sugar shapes such as pilgrim hats.Shopping.com: Thanksgiving Cakes Cupcakes Cookies Pilgrim Hat Shaped Sugars
- Use yellow and white buttercream frosting on orange cupcakes and make them look like miniature pumpkin pies.Cupcakes a go-go Sarasota: Main Page
- Place a green gumdrop on the center of an orange-colored cupcake and you have an instant pumpkin.
